1. Fairmont Makati (from USD 166)

Fairmont Makati ranks among the best hotels in the Philippines’ capital region. Each of its 280 rooms boasts an elegant design, top-quality amenities, and a breathtaking view of the city skyline. Located in the main commercial and business district of Makati, the hotel is located within walking distance of some of the city’s most exclusive haunts. In fact, the hotels in the area boast a private, underground walkway that takes guests directly to the city’s most exclusive malls and night clubs! Fairmont Makati is also just a 15-minute drive from Ninoy Aquino International Airport, which makes this an ideal stay for any jet-setter hoping to see the best that Makati has to offer.

2. Dusit Thani Manila (from USD 116)

Also located in Makati City’s business district, Dusit Thani is one of the most beloved hotels in the Philippines. Having maintained a five-star rating through the years, Dusit Thani Manila is best known for its consistently excellent service, top-notch amenities, as well as its highly convenient location. Dusit Thani Manila is also home to some top-rated restaurants. In particular, the hotel’s Benjarong Thai Restaurant is one of the best in the city for authentic gourmet Thai cuisine. Dusit Thani Manila is just 25 minutes away from Ninoy Aquino International Airport, making it very popular among those traveling to Metro Manila for business.

3. Sofitel Philippine Plaza Manila (from USD 201)

Designed by Leandro Locsin and Ildefonso P. Santos, two of the Philippines’ foremost architects, the Sofitel Philippine Plaza Manila is not just one of the most stunning hotels in Manila, but also a piece of Philippine culture and history. Situated next to Manila Bay, nearly all of the hotel’s elegant 600 suites boast breathtaking views of the famed sunsets by the bay. In addition to its historical and cultural importance, the hotel is best known for its excellent service, with its staff noted for exhibiting the warmth and hospitality that Filipinos are known for.
